Transaction deab328214e1d76cb3ee94d0cfcc16d690b8fd3276d607568392da2b7baf6f8f
1 Input
1 Output
-
deab328214e1d76cb3ee94d0cfcc16d690b8fd3276d607568392da2b7baf6f8f:0
- value
- 19807200
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 474e02ab4ec1778594660832dcbf61987118cf72 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17W2Rt1M1FkKrDZuyjxiYKcCTiKSGCztgS